Vincent Poon created PHOENIX-4990: ------------------------------------- Summary: When stopping IndexWriter, give tasks a chance to complete Key: PHOENIX-4990 URL: https://issues.apache.org/jira/browse/PHOENIX-4990 Project: Phoenix Issue Type: Bug Affects Versions: 4.14.0 Reporter: Vincent Poon Assignee: Vincent Poon
We've seen a race condition where an index write failure happens when a coprocessor is shutting down. Since we don't give the index writer threads a chance to complete when shutdownNow() is called, there is a chance the coprocessor shuts down its HTables while an index writer thread is in PhoenixIndexFailurePolicy trying to disable an index, which ends up using a closed HTable and received RejectedExecutionException -- This message was sent by Atlassian JIRA (v7.6.3#76005)